ROHS - Directive 2002/95/EC

The Chemistry, Health, and Environment Laboratory provides testing services for medical devices, electronics, and products exported to Europe.

The laboratory has ISO 17025 accreditation from ANSI National Accreditation Board ANAB.

The Restriction of Hazardous Substances (RoHS) tests have international recognition.

Most of the laboratory's activity focuses on product safety, environment, and public protection aspects.

Restriction of Hazardous Substances Directive 2002/95/EC of the European Commission, which restricts the use of six hazardous substances used in the manufacture of certain electronics and appliances: lead, mercury, cadmium, chrome (chrome VI and Cr6+). PBB flame retardants, PBDE flame retardants, phthalates (DEHP, BBP, DBP, DIBP)

Both RoHS 2 and RoHS 3 tests can be conducted
